Below is our recent interview with Erik Larson, CEO & Co-founder at eIMPACT:

Q: Erik, what is eIMPACT?

A: eIMPACT is a labor market data visualization software company based in the Portland, Oregon metro area. The company’s cloud-based platform is utilized by workforce and economic development organizations around the country. Clients of eIMPACT include cities, such as Escondido, CA and College Park, MD, counties, such as Orange County, CA, workforce organizations, like Workforce Solutions Capital Area (Austin, TX), chambers of commerce, such as the Greater Federal Way Chamber, WA, and the Green Bay Chamber, WI, as well as a range of different economic organizations such as the Flint & Genesee Economic Alliance, MI.

Q: Any highlights on your recent announcement?

A: The myCareerPathway™ Dashboard was originally created to help solve a critical gap in workers undergoing a job or career transition: how to gain insights into the labor market, in-demand skills, and compensation trends based on real, up-to-date data. Currently, this type of search is an opaque undertaking, leaving candidates working in the dark at an already stressful time. The product features data by Lightcast, the global leader in labor market information and analytics.

eIMPACT’s also works with Labor Market Information (LMI) data visualization dashboards for public data reporting, as well as dashboards for business attraction programs within economic development organizations and to report progress to stakeholders.

CareerSource North Central Florida will roll out the myCareerPathway™ Dashboard in all their one-stop locations as well as through a web-based portal, serving thousands of customers each month. The organization will be featuring the product at the upcoming Florida Workforce Summit, which will take place in Orlando in September.

Q: Can you give us more insights into your offering?

A: The product is cloud-based, accessible on any device, and embeddable into other software platforms. Users can generate their own career pathway dashboard on-the-fly, in just a couple of seconds based on their location and job title. Many users are also using the tool to explore new career options based on their transferable skills – a major trend in the global labor market.
